Output d66c1cc40fc65aece7a5f1af339650667deb4032b68f1737024b768f6159d04e:2

value
1564628600
script pubkey
OP_0 OP_PUSHBYTES_20 9604c46a5424ba61ceab12e3bf3f253cd2231fac
address
ltc1qjczvg6j5yjaxrn4tzt3m70e98nfzx8av2xqlye
transaction
d66c1cc40fc65aece7a5f1af339650667deb4032b68f1737024b768f6159d04e
spent
true